Dicladispa megacantha is a species of beetle of the family Chrysomelidae. It is found in Bangladesh, Bhutan, China (Yunnan), India (Assam, Meghalaya, Sikkim, West Bengal), Indonesia (Java), Laos, Myanmar, Thailand and Vietnam.
Life history
No host plant has been documented for this species.[2]
